A man from north London has been charged with operating dark web forums that facilitated the distribution of child sexual abuse materials. Matthew Slate, 36, from Haringey, appeared in Highbury Corner Magistrates‘ Court, where it was revealed that he was allegedly part of a global organized network.
According to the court, Slate served as a „global moderator“ under the alias Loudechoes on a platform known as Olympus, with his illicit activities reportedly spanning over 18 months. He is also accused of involvement with another suspected child abuse site from July 20, 2023, to June 15, 2024.
Charges and Allegations
The case has been forwarded to Wood Green Crown Court, where a plea hearing is scheduled for February 19. Prosecutors claim that in August 2024, Slate used the cryptocurrency Monero to pay for hosting a third forum, SoulCloud 2, on the dark web.
Slate faces multiple charges, including:
- Three counts of arranging or facilitating the sexual exploitation of a child under 13 years of age
- Two counts of participating in the criminal activities of an organized crime group
- Six counts of distributing indecent photographs or pseudo-photographs of a child
- Three counts of making indecent photographs or pseudo-photographs of a child
- One count of possessing a prohibited image of a child
It is alleged that Slate enabled the sharing of over 2,000 images and videos depicting child sexual abuse between July 2023 and February 2025, while accumulating approximately 57,000 illegal images, including more than 10,000 classified in the most severe category of abuse.
Bail Conditions
Slate has been released on bail with nine conditions, which include complying with requests from the National Crime Agency to access his electronic devices. He is prohibited from using encryption or data-wiping software, messaging applications such as Snapchat, WhatsApp, and Signal, as well as accessing the dark web or deleting his browsing history.
Furthermore, he is required to reside overnight at his home in north London or an alternative address in Epping and is barred from having unsupervised contact with children.
